The popularity of politics on YouTube

A NewsLink Indiana student crew did a story about Friday's visit to Muncie by Hillary Clinton. That story posted to You Tube, has gotten over 300 hits. There's plenty of other videos from the event online too. The Star Press carried the speech live on it's web site and the Indy stations were in attendance as well.
At least one of the viewers of the NLI story was really looking closely. The crew had exhausted it's good wide shots and took one from the feed to end the story on. The line was about continuing to campaign in Indiana and other states. The comment from the You Tube viewer called out the crew for using one shot that wasn't from Muncie.
I know You Tube has a lot of interest, but just didn't think people would be watching that critically!
